This isn't a big problem but I've been curious about this for a while now.

I've got haml installed on a number of projects, all hosted in svn 
repos. Every now and then, the vendor/plugins/haml/init.rb will show 
changes and want to be committed, and I can't work out why.

A typical diff from svn will show something like this:

Index: vendor/plugins/haml/init.rb
===================================================================
--- vendor/plugins/haml/init.rb (revision 92)
+++ vendor/plugins/haml/init.rb (working copy)
@@ -4,5 +4,4 @@
    require 'haml' # From gem
  end

-# Load Haml and Sass
  Haml.init_rails(binding)


Now I can see what is changed, but I have no idea why. This usually 
happens around every 10 commits, not that that helps much but it shows 
it's not constant and it's not rare.

I've taken to writing commit logs like "HAML doing it's thing" which 
make me smile, but would probably confuse anyone else hugely.

Does anyone have any ideas about why this happens? Am I the only one 
this happens to or do other people see this?
